Advise Wise updates research PDF for compliance and audit

Published on

Advise Wise has announced the release of its improved research PDF document.

The sourcing platform for later life advisers claims the new document facilitates compliance and audit processes, offering advisers a more efficient and transparent way to access key quote information.

The upgraded research document showcases all crucial quote information, including any product range exclusions, in a clear and concise format. It is designed to make it easier for advisers to navigate through search results and filter options. With its improved layout, the new research PDF allows users to quickly find the information they need, enhancing the overall user experience and ultimately the advice process, Advise Wise claims.

Benjamin Wells, head of product and development at Advise Wise, said: “We’re excited to roll out this new version of our research PDF document. This update is part of our ongoing commitment to providing best-in-class tools for financial advisers. Our new format ensures compliance and audit needs are met while delivering a streamlined, user-friendly experience.”

Advisers can download the enhanced research PDF by clicking on the ‘Download PDF’ icon, located at the top right above the search results on the Advise Wise platform.
